Giant Icebergs Created By Japan Tsunami

August 10, 2011 by Bruce Sussman Leave a Comment

You're looking at the icy shores of Antarctica--8,000 miles from Japan. It's a place called the Sulzberger Ice Shelf.  This satellite image on the right was taken on March 11, 2011--just hours after that day's great Japan quake and Tsunami.
